La Maison du Compagnon de la Sarre Inc is a charitable organization based in La Sarre, Quebec, classified by the CRA under core health care. It appears on the charity register the way hospitals, universities, and other publicly funded bodies do — to issue tax receipts — rather than as a donation-driven charity in the usual sense. In its fiscal year ending March 31, 2024, it reported $748K in revenue and $716K in expenditures.

Its funding that year was roughly 92% from government. Government funding is the majority of its budget. In 2024, 3 other registered charities reported granting it a combined $225K.

Compared with 739 health institutions of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 53% of peers. Its highest-paid positions fell in the $40,000–79,999 range (4 positions in that band). The charity reported 19 permanent full-time positions.

Revenue has grown substantially over its filings on record here, from $392K in 2020 to $748K in 2024.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 5 names.
